Mekong Tourism Newsletter – June 2025 Issue

Tourism is surging across the Mekong. But how do we sustainably manage this growth? Ahead of the Mekong Tourism Forum 2025 in Luang Prabang (June 25–27), explore how the Greater Mekong Subregion countries are handling rising tourism numbers while protecting culture and community.

From Viet Nam’s Golden Visa to Lao PDR’s Green Destination push, get the full picture – download the newsletter now.
